First off, from the point of view of the linear theory of sound waves, you're plain wrong. Two waves of any frequencies will only interact additively in linear media -- so no low frequencies are created through their interaction (unless non-linear effects come into play, but those usually create higher, not lower, order harmonics afaik). Beating is merely an interpretation of a modulating wave, the reality is the Fourier spectrum.

Second, as far as I know our hearing is composed of linear excitation elements (they have a definite bandwidth), and this is confirmed pretty well by experiments with human hearing -- you can see the threshold of our hearing at about 20kHz and that we experience tones of different frequencies fairly independently. Those assumptions imply that two tones, one at e.g. 50kHz and another at 50.001kHz are inaudible, end of story.

You can actually do this experiment yourself if you have a signal generator that can do 1Hz amplitude modulation and drive a transducer with a non-negligible sensitivity in that range.

It's a common misconception that vinyl necessarily imparts all possible audio benefits to whatever is pressed into it.

Now, I'm not Gaga's recording engineer, and for all I know you're absolutely right and her & her team remastered each track without compression for the vinyl pressing. Considering how rare such a process is in industry recording, however, I doubt it. I assume that really the difference you're hearing is typical of all vinyl recordings: a type of distortion that comes from both pressing and playback through an RIAA preamplifier.

People use all sorts of terms to describe the difference between vinyl & digital sound, but mostly descriptors center around words like "warmer," or "more open" or "brighter." These are really just beneficial side-effects of the standards developed to overcome vinyl's limitations as a recording medium.

So, in reality quality and compression come in to play long before the pressing actually occurs, on the mastered track itself. I've come to realize that a poorly handled transfer to vinyl will often sound not nearly as clear or detailed as a high-res or even "Mastered for iTunes" track.

You're thinking about absolute range of a human system. Yes, I can look into shadows and my iris will imperceptibly dilate. Similarly, the stapedius muscle can dampen input to the oval window. So you can appreciate a wide dynamic range. But instantaneously, your retina is only good for about 7-8 EV steps. Modern imaging sensors deliver well over 10 EV, some deliver more than 14. Depending on which format you save to, you could be throwing away half the information! So, much like a artist should record 24/192, a photographer should be saving to RAW. But no monitor or film or the human eye will ever capture all that range in one instant. So, especially for temporal media, like audio and video, that space can be scoped down in the interest of space saving without any perceptible loss.
